使用关键字从pdf中提取页面

时间:2014-06-09 14:03:38

标签: excel-vba pdf search vba excel

好的,所以我非常肯定我无法使用excel vb或免费使用。

我正在编写这些宏用于工作,其中一个需要能够根据关键字选择pdf。 然后进入pdf,使用一组不同的关键字搜索页面标题或页面上的文本。

当找到与第二组中某个关键字匹配的页面时,它会将整个页面提取为单页pdf。

然后可以将其附加到电子邮件中。

这只是宏目的的一小部分。 根据我的理解,我可能必须找到一个SDK,付费,并在C#或VisualBasic中编写一个单独的程序,该程序在宏需要时运行。

我甚至不需要代码,也许只是正确方向的一个点:D

1 个答案:

答案 0 :(得分:1)

最后,我得到了一个名为pdftk.exe的程序,免费,并在命令行中运行。 有了这个,我可以将书签列表导出到txtfile。 搜索文本文件中的字符串/关键字。 跳下一两行并获取相关的页码。 然后使用相同的exe来提取该页面并保存为特定名称,然后我的vba宏可以获取新创建的1页pdf。

我已经看到这个网站上的代码创建了延迟,而另一个进程正在做它的事情,所以我也会尝试实现它。